Introduction to Equipment Cleaning SOPs

In the pharmaceutical industry, maintaining stringent standards for equipment cleaning is critical to ensure product quality, patient safety, and compliance with regulatory requirements. An effective Equipment Cleaning SOP not only facilitates compliance with Good Manufacturing Practices (GMP) but also enhances data integrity throughout the production process. The expectations from regulatory agencies such as the FDA, EMA, and MHRA make it essential for pharma companies to establish robust cleaning protocols that are uniformly applied across all departments. This article serves as a comprehensive guide for developing an effective site-wide Equipment Cleaning SOP roadmap.

Understanding the Regulatory Landscape

Before developing an Equipment Cleaning SOP, it is essential to comprehend the relevant regulations that govern cleaning procedures in the pharmaceutical sector. In the United States, the FDA mandates that all pharmaceutical manufacturers adhere to GMP standards, which include maintaining a clean manufacturing environment. Similarly, in Europe, the EMA emphasizes the critical importance of cleanliness as part of their guidelines. The UK’s MHRA has also established regulations ensuring that cleaning processes are thoroughly documented and auditable as part of achieving inspection readiness. Understanding these guidelines enables organizations to tailor their SOPs to meet the necessary compliance requirements.

Step-by-Step Guide to Crafting an Equipment Cleaning SOP

Step 1: Define the Objective

Establish a clear objective for your Equipment Cleaning SOP. The objective should encapsulate the necessity for maintaining cleanliness and preventing cross-contamination, ensuring compliance with regulatory inspections while emphasizing the significance of data integrity.

Step 2: Determine the Scope

Identify which equipment requires cleaning SOPs, including the various types of equipment utilized throughout the manufacturing process. It’s essential to cover all critical equipment, such as mixing tanks, filling machines, and packaging lines, and any associated auxiliary equipment.

Step 3: Identify Responsibilities

Clearly delineate responsibilities among the personnel involved in the cleaning process. Designate a Cleaning Supervisor responsible for ensuring compliance with the SOP and proper execution during cleaning operations, supported by trained cleaning personnel.

Step 4: List Required Materials

Detail all cleaning agents, tools, and personal protective equipment (PPE) that are required. Ensure that the materials are suitable for the type of equipment being cleaned and compliant with chemical safety standards. It’s advisable to include Safety Data Sheets (SDS) for all cleaning agents used.

Step 6: Validation Protocols

Establish procedures for validating the effectiveness of cleaning operations. This includes defining acceptance criteria and methodologies for sampling and testing cleaned equipment to confirm compliance with predefined cleanliness standards, ensuring no residues remain.

Step 7: Implement Training Protocols

Ensure all personnel involved in cleaning have received sufficient training. Outline the prerequisites for training, including certification processes, to maintain SOP compliance for those executing cleaning operations.

Step 8: Develop a Change Control Process

A robust change control process is essential to manage revisions to the Equipment Cleaning SOP. This should dictate how changes are documented, reviewed, and approved while ensuring all employees are informed about any modifications.

Step 9: Reference Relevant Guidelines

Include references to relevant guidelines or regulations to support the SOP’s validity. Referencing industry standards ensures the SOP aligns with best practices and regulatory expectations.

Ensuring SOP Compliance for Inspections

Maintaining compliance with your Equipment Cleaning SOP is key to ensuring successful outcomes during regulatory inspections. Regulatory agencies such as the FDA, EMA, and MHRA will scrutinize the documentation and execution of cleaning procedures. It is vital to regularly review and revise the SOP in line with operational changes, incident reports, and inspection findings. Furthermore, internal audits or inspections should be conducted to assure adherence to SOP compliance, facilitating continuous improvement across all levels of the organization.

Continuous Improvement as a Core Principle

Embedding a culture of continuous improvement within the cleaning SOP framework fosters an environment that emphasizes quality and compliance. Metrics should be defined, tracked, and analyzed to identify trends and areas for improvement. Techniques such as root cause analysis can be employed when deviations arise, ensuring proactive measures are implemented to mitigate risks. Regular training sessions should be conducted to update personnel on best practices and enhance compliance with the Equipment Cleaning SOP.
